A Life Remembered . . .
Albert C. Uhl, Sr.

December 27, 1935 - November 11, 2005

Albert C. Uhl, Sr., age 69, of Trinidad Street, Butler, Pennsylvania, died Friday, November 11, 2005 at 11:52 a.m. in the Butler Memorial Hospital.

Born December 27, 1935 in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, he was the son of A. C. and Daisey Mingler Uhl.

Mr. Uhl was protestant by faith.

Mr. Uhl was self-employed as a diesel mechanic. He previously worked for DuBrook and Lakeview Golf Course. He served with the Civil Engineer Corps during the Vietnam War. He was a member of the Independent Order of Foresters. Mr. Uhl was an avid hunter, fisherman and golfer. .
